What Features Should You Look for in the Best Aftermarket Battery Charger for Sony A6000?

When searching for the best aftermarket battery charger for the Sony A6000, consider the following features:

  • Compatibility: Ensure the charger is specifically designed for Sony A6000 batteries, such as the NP-FW50 model.
  • Charging Speed: Look for chargers that provide fast charging capabilities, allowing you to quickly power up your batteries.
  • Dual Charging Capability: Some chargers can charge two batteries simultaneously, which is beneficial for extended shooting sessions.
  • Smart Charging Technology: Chargers with smart technology can optimize charging based on battery condition, preventing overcharging and prolonging battery life.
  • Portability: A compact and lightweight design makes it easier to carry the charger while traveling or on shoots.
  • LED Indicators: Chargers with LED indicators help you monitor the charging status at a glance, showing whether the battery is charging or fully charged.
  • Durability and Build Quality: A well-constructed charger ensures longevity, making it resistant to wear and tear during use.

Compatibility: It is crucial that the charger is compatible with the Sony A6000’s battery model, NP-FW50, to ensure proper fit and functionality. Using an incompatible charger can result in inefficient charging or even damage to the battery.

Charging Speed: The best aftermarket chargers should offer fast charging capabilities that can significantly reduce the time it takes to recharge your batteries. Quick charging is particularly useful for photographers and videographers who need to minimize downtime between shoots.

Dual Charging Capability: Opt for chargers that allow for the simultaneous charging of two batteries. This feature is especially handy for users who frequently use their cameras, as it enables them to have a backup battery ready to go at all times.

Smart Charging Technology: Chargers equipped with smart technology can automatically adjust the charging current and voltage based on the battery’s condition. This feature not only ensures efficient charging but also protects the battery from potential damage caused by overcharging.

Portability: A compact design is essential for photographers on the go. A lightweight and portable charger can easily fit into camera bags without adding much weight, making it convenient for travel and outdoor shoots.

LED Indicators: Having LED indicators on the charger is beneficial for monitoring the charging process. These indicators can provide real-time updates, allowing users to quickly check if their batteries are charging or fully charged without needing to remove them from the charger.

Durability and Build Quality: Invest in a charger made of high-quality materials that can withstand regular use and potential impacts. A durable charger will offer better protection against environmental factors, ensuring it lasts longer and remains reliable over time.

How Does a Dual Charger Improve Efficiency for the Sony A6000?

A dual charger enhances efficiency for the Sony A6000 by allowing simultaneous charging of multiple batteries, ensuring that photographers can quickly swap out depleted batteries without downtime.

  • Simultaneous Charging: A dual charger can charge two batteries at the same time, significantly reducing the waiting period between shoots. This is particularly beneficial for photographers who rely on extended shooting sessions, as they can have a backup battery ready while the primary battery charges.
  • Battery Health Monitoring: Many dual chargers come equipped with features that monitor battery health and charge levels. This allows users to maintain optimal battery performance over time, preventing overcharging and ensuring that each battery is charged to its full capacity without degrading its lifespan.
  • Travel Convenience: Having a dual charger means fewer chargers to carry, as one device can handle multiple batteries. This is especially useful for travel, where space and weight are considerations; a compact dual charger minimizes gear bulk while maximizing charging capability.
  • Cost-Effectiveness: Investing in a dual charger often proves to be more economical in the long run. By being able to charge two batteries at once, photographers can save on the cost of additional chargers while ensuring that they always have a charged battery ready to go.
  • Versatility: Many dual chargers are designed to accommodate various battery types or brands, making them versatile tools for photographers who own multiple camera systems. This adaptability means that a single charger can serve multiple purposes, enhancing its value for users with diverse equipment.

What Are the Common Issues Users Face with Aftermarket Chargers for Sony A6000?

Common issues users face with aftermarket chargers for the Sony A6000 include:

  • Compatibility Problems: Some aftermarket chargers may not be fully compatible with Sony A6000 batteries, leading to either improper charging or failure to charge altogether.
  • Build Quality Concerns: Many aftermarket chargers are made with lower-quality materials, which can result in durability issues, such as overheating or physical damage over time.
  • Charging Speed Variability: Aftermarket chargers can offer varying charging speeds, with some models taking significantly longer to charge batteries compared to original Sony chargers.
  • Lack of Safety Features: Unlike OEM chargers, many aftermarket options may lack essential safety features such as overcharge protection, which can pose risks to battery longevity and safety.
  • Inconsistent Performance: Users often report inconsistent performance with aftermarket chargers, such as failing to recognize the battery or providing unreliable power levels.

Compatibility problems arise when the charger does not match the specifications required by Sony A6000 batteries, which can lead to frustration as users may find that their batteries do not charge or that the charger is unable to communicate effectively with the battery.

Build quality concerns are prevalent since many aftermarket chargers are produced at lower costs, which can result in inferior materials that may not withstand regular usage, leading to issues like melting, short-circuiting, or even catching fire.

Charging speed variability is another critical issue; while some aftermarket chargers can charge batteries quickly, others may take much longer than expected, which can be inconvenient for users who need to charge batteries in a timely manner.

Lack of safety features in some aftermarket chargers is a significant drawback, as these chargers may not include necessary protections against overcharging, leading to potential damage to both the battery and the camera, or even posing a fire hazard.

Inconsistent performance is a common complaint among users of aftermarket chargers; some may experience their chargers intermittently failing to charge, which can be particularly troublesome during important shoots when reliability is crucial.
